how to answer technical interview questions

Even if you never land on an ideal solution, showing that you are calm and resourceful under pressure is still a good thing to demonstrate to the hiring manager. Technical Interview Questions are hard to crack unless the candidate has a mix of both the psychological and practice skills. Ask questions to make sure you really understand what you’re trying to solve, before you actually start solving the question. A tough question can throw off a job interview, but knowing what to expect and how to answer difficult questions can help job-seekers make the best impression. Pro Tip #3: Be Ready for Open-Ended Questions. For example, if you’re asked to “traverse a tree,” you really don’t know enough yet to solve the problem. Cookies help us deliver our services. Are there things you might be missing? HR interview questions and answers are a way of testing you in and out. Can you use other information to your advantage so you can do less work? Show your logical thinking and process for each answer because the employer doesn't just want to know your answer, they want to know how you got there. That’s right. Report violations, 101 Enterprise Architecture Interview Questions », 7 Interview Questions That Reveal Everything », 10 Questions That Pop Up In Every Enterprise Architecture Interview », 50 Change Management Interview Questions », 70 Communication Skills Interview Questions, 106 Executive Leadership Interview Questions. Now, for instance, don’t say “I know Ruby but don’t know Java”. It's a challenging role that demands a challenging interview. When technical questions arise during the interview, it’s fine to ask for clarification and to “think aloud” as you work through possible solutions for hypothetical problems. Most interviewers are interested in whether you can ask intelligent questions. Having a mastery of these topics will likely give you all the necessary knowledge to tackle the problems you will encounter during the technical interview. Having sat on the other side of the table and interviewed over 700 software engineering candidates, I have some strong opinions on good and bad answers. The interviewer wants to check if you’re comfortable with the language. That means two candidates can arrive at the same (correct) solution to a problem, yet still be judged differently based on how they arrived at that answer. By Jeff Gillis. Another typical question that interviewers will ask is about your weaknesses. Sometimes the best technical interview questions are—and they’re more revealing that you might expect. Upload Your RésuméEmployers want candidates like you. How to get hired by nailing the 20 most common interview questions employers ask. If you want to measure programming style give the interviewer an assignment (implement an storage service ) and you will get a good sense as to how he/she writes code. * If you find the questions difficult, or have no idea what you would say to the hiring managers, have a look at a new eBook I put together for you, Ace Your Behavioral-Based Job Interview. In real production code you will have acceptance criteria to validate the correctness of the implementation and a set of tests. Recently, I came across a popular book which suggests tricks and techniques to deal with the interviewer – ‘Inside The Tech Interview’ written by Author, Trainer and Software Engineer at Microsoft, Michael Reinhardt. Do you understand the question? The latter also shows the interviewer that you can come up with a baseline solution, atop which you can further iterate. There are tons of blogs like this online as well as numerous books online on how to “crack the coding interview” the truth is, every interviewer has their own opinion as to what “a good answer” is. I want to share with you the best strategy for handling technical questions, especially when you don’t know the answer. It's a fact: Knowing how to answer the tough questions in a job interview in ways that are both honest and powerful can help you impress the interviewer and land the job. Possible Answer #1: “I rate my leadership skills an 8 out of 10. Technical interview preparation is key to being successful.Candidates should not assume that they will know all of the answers just because they have a degree in the subject. Basically, y … Should we restrict the usage of such languages… if there are not enough people who understand it?! There is much to learn, but I have always been a strong leader. A developer, for example, may hope to have developed a small project during that time, while a tech manager may want to have analyzed internal processes. It is even more troublesome when the interviewers are not even team members the candidate might work with (we hire for the company not for a specific team). In my years of experience as interviewer and interviewee there is no formula other than approaching jobs in brute force manner which is sad, apply to 10 jobs, interview sequentially and 1 or more are bound to work or the same questions might be re-asked by and then you can “ACE” the interview. and come back to it after the interview. It's important to develop a technique to effectively answer interview questions in such situations. If you get stuck, keep iterating through more examples, and thinking about how the problem at hand (hopefully) bears similarities to ones you’ve solved in the past. Some technical interview questions can involve a riddle or brainteaser. Example: “I worked as a retail manager at a department store during prom season. These 7 interview habits will greatly improve your answers. for different types of interviews. A candidate’s response will give you insights into their overall understanding of … Speaking of which…. Technical interview questions are asked so that the interviewer can understand how you use your analytical reasoning skills to form a solution to a problem. (Yes, many employers still ask those sorts of crazy questions, just to see you work the problem.) Hopefully, nobody will ask you tricky questions on your next job interview. Technical interviews can be extremely daunting. All rights reserved. How would you verify the answer was correct? Be interactive when you’re asked unfamiliar or highly-involved technical questions. And they love to see how you work through unfamiliar issues or foreign concepts. What is the structure of the tree? Provide a brief summary of the situation, your role in the situation, the action you put into place to resolve the issue, and how the issue was resolved as a result. Once you understand the question, use any available examples to help solve the problem; examples allow you to pick up on patterns and generalizations that apply to the question at hand. 1. Reply. Should you traverse it in a particular way? Our collection of behavioral and situational interview questions includes thousands of the most commonly asked questions. Interviewing is a game just like dating after awhile (once in production) the real you comes out and my experience has taught me that a good interviewer not always is a good software engineer. If you don’t get the best answer, make a note in your notebook (you brought something to take notes on during the interview, right?) Please post more technical questions and answers then we can increase our knowledge. Most technical questions are designed to reveal how you think, communicate, and solve problems. Answer: The work of a technical support engineer is to maintain and monitor the computers and the networks of an organization.

Shire Of Ravensthorpe, Qar To Pkr Forecast, Bmi Calculator Kg, Alicia Vitarelli Wedding, Unaccompanied Minors On Flights, Dubai Pronunciation Arabic, Devin Wilson Obituary,

Leave a Reply

Your email address will not be published. Required fields are marked *